A 22-year-old boy becomes youngest doctor in Ghana

A 22-year-old individual named Kwaku Boakye Gyamfi has captured the attention of Twitter users in Ghana for achieving the remarkable feat of becoming one of the country’s youngest doctors.

Following the successful graduation of the 2023 class of medical students at the University of Cape Coast (UCC), the phrase “Congratulations Doc” has been trending on the social media platform X in Ghana.

Numerous graduates took to social media to announce their newly acquired medical degrees, expressing their joy and readiness to begin their medical careers.

Among them, Kweku Boakye Gyamfi, one of the accomplished graduates, stood out. He shared the exhilarating news on Instagram, along with two images, and captioned them with:

“Finally Dr. Kwaku Boakye Gyamfi. Six long years are finally over. Thank you, God.” This post left many in awe of his achievement.
